Tara Seshan, Head of ChatGPT Work and Codex at OpenAI, discusses the shift to "persistent AI coworkers" on Lenny's Podcast.
Key Points:
- From Rowing to Steering: As AI handles continuous execution, humans shift to steering—focusing on direction, taste, and accountability.
- Product Design: Requires a unified framework integrating models, environments, permissions, and collaboration interfaces.
- Ambition: Ambition becomes the bottleneck; PMs must elevate others' goals.
- Planning: Building for model capabilities 2-3 months out is essential.
